Soldier Health and Readiness Pose Challenges
 
 
Thursday, June 28, 2018

The Army has made great progress in improving soldier health and readiness, but 17 percent of the force is considered obese, 14 percent has been diagnosed with a sleep disorder and 24 percent has a behavioral health disorder.

Clearly, there is room for continued improvement, panelists said during a discussion about the health of the force during the Army Medical Symposium and Exposition hosted in San Antonio by the Association of the U.S. Army’s Institute of Land Warfare.
